What You’ll Learn

In our program, you’ll learn everything from basic first aid to advanced life-saving techniques. You’ll develop hands-on skills in:

  • CPR and first response
  • Patient assessment and care
  • Advanced airway management
  • Trauma and cardiac care
  • Emergency transportation procedures

Plus, you’ll practice in real-world settings with our state-of-the-art equipment and labs. This hands-on experience ensures you’re prepared for the challenges of a career in emergency medical services.

Your Path to Certification

When you complete the program, you’ll be ready to take the National Registry of Emergency Medical Technicians (NREMT) exam, which is your key to becoming a certified paramedic. This certification opens doors to exciting opportunities in emergency medical services, fire departments, hospitals, and more.

Career Opportunities After Graduation

Once you’re certified, you can start a career as a:

  • Paramedic
  • Emergency Medical Technician (EMT)
  • Firefighter/EMT
  • Emergency department technician
  • And more!

Emergency medical professionals are in high demand, so you’ll have plenty of job opportunities waiting for you after graduation.
